The reason for the short is that the voltage sources in the simulation are ideal and have no resistance. Thus the voltage sources short current through each other.

@Teshaxd, I believe that there are some reasons why voltage sources could be connected in parallel. One reason is to increase the current capacity of Li-Po batteries. However, you are correct that this is usually a bad (and possibly dangerous) idea as the batteries must be matched and charged to the same amount. Extra circuitry is required to make it safer.

EC voltage sources are ‘perfect’ in that they have no output resistance which a real voltage source would have - for example, the internal resistance of a battery. To overcome this you can add a very small resistance in series with the source, perhaps 0.1 Ohm.
